IPS officer Amitabh Thakur gives his arrest in alleged rape case 

Lucknow: IPS officer Amitabh Thakur along with his wife activist Dr Nutan Thakur, on Sunday, reached the Senior Superintendent of Police (SSP) Manzil Saini's residence to give his arrest as a mark of protest for no legal proceedings in the alleged rape case filed against him about two years back.

Amitabh stated, "Lucknow police was unable to provide the justice that is why I decided to give my arrest in front of SSP Manzil Saini."

What else Amitabh Thakur and Nutan Thakur stated:

  • The FIR was registered in mysterious circumstances on 13 July 2015.
  • We were getting regular threats from Mulayam Singh, but no investigation was done since last 18 months.
  • Investigating officer CO Gomtinagar has not collected any evidence in the case and has not even visited the alleged scene of crime.
  • Police officer knows that the case is false but do not have courage to prove because of the high level political pressure.

SSP Manzil Saini said, "We need a time of one month to investigate the matter."
